2014 BND to CAD Performance & Market Timing Review

Analysis of key historical highlights and timing insights for 2014

During 2014, the BND to CAD exchange rate experienced significant fluctuation. The market reached its absolute peak on December 16, valuing the pair at 0.8906. Conversely, the yearly low was recorded on January 5, dropping to 0.8384.

This high-to-low spread represents a total annual volatility of 0.0522 CAD. From a start-to-finish perspective, comparing the January average rate of 0.8580 to the December average rate of 0.8770, the exchange rate registered a net change of 2.22% (reflecting a strengthening trend).

Looking at year-over-year peak valuations, the 2014 high of 0.8906 was up 4.57% compared to the 2013 peak of 0.8517, indicating shifts in long-term support levels.

Seasonal Halves (H1 vs H2)

Seasonal

The average exchange rate in the first half of the year (H1: Jan–Jun) was 0.8699, compared to 0.8735 in the second half (H2: Jul–Dec). This shows that the rate was stronger in the second half (Jul–Dec) by a margin of 0.0036 points.

Volatility Range Comparison

Volatility

The most volatile month in 2014 was January, with a trading range of 0.0362 CAD (High: 0.8746 / Low: 0.8384). On the other end, August was the most stable month, with a tight range of 0.0094 CAD (High: 0.8782 / Low: 0.8688).
